Bangladesh players gain in ranking despite ODI whitewash

DHAKA, Oct 15, 2025 (BSS)- Bangladesh cricketers made a positive progress in 
the ICC weekly rankings, released today, despite tasting a 3-0 ODI sweep at 
the hands of Afghanistan.

Mehidy Hasan Miraz who took five wickets in the series gained four places to 
24th and Tanzim Hasan Sakib advanced 24 places to 67th in the bowling 
rankings.

Tanzim was not part of the squad in the third ODI but claimed five wickets in 
the first two matches.

The Bangladesh bowlers made considerably well, only to see the batters ruin 
all their hard yards.

But Towhid Hridoy got the reward of his half-century in the first match by 
leapfrogging seven places to sit 42nd. He is now the highest ranked 
Bangladesh batter.

After scoring 56 in the first match, Hridoy failed in the last two matches, 
making only 24 and 7 respectively.

Meanwhile, Afghanistan leg-spinner Rashid Khan has returned to the top 
position in the ICC Men's ODI Bowling Rankings after playing a crucial role 
in a 3-0 series win over Bangladesh in Abu Dhabi.

Rashid, who finished with 11 wickets in the series that included a five-for 
in the second match, has moved up five slots to take the top position with 
710 rating points, 30 more than South Africa spinner Keshav Maharaj, who is 
in second spot. Rashid had become No. 1 for the first time in September 2018 
and last occupied the position in November 2024.

Seam bowler Azmatullah Omarzai has achieved a career-best 21st position after 
a 19-spot leap with seven wickets in the series.

In the batting rankings, Afghan opener Ibrahim Zadran has leapt eight places 
to reach a career-best second position after top-scoring with a total of 213 
runs that won him the Player of the Series award. He is now just behind 
Indian captain Shubman Gill.

Zadran (764 points) has achieved the highest-ever batting rating by any 
Afghanistan player, surpassing Rahmanullah Gurbaz's 686 points achieved last 
November, and his second position is also the highest position by any ODI 
batter from his country.
